0.16.3: Added OKVIS support (tested only on EuRoC dataset). Added IMU/IMUThread classes. Added OdomOKVIS/ConfigPath and Rtabmap/ImagesAlreadyRectified parameters. MainWindow, limited odom local feature map to maximum 50 meters from current pose (to avoid VTK glitching with near/far clipping plane).
